As soon as the design is full, the job moves into PCB fabrication and PCB manufacturing. PCB fabrication companies, PCB fabricators, and PCB manufacturers change the electronic design right into a physical board. This process can include PCB lamination, exploration, plating, etching, solder mask application, silkscreen printing, and surface completing. Various products are chosen depending on the application, such as FR4, Rogers PCB material, ceramic PCB material, aluminum PCB boards, polyimide flex PCB, or various other specialty laminates. Due to the fact that the material's dielectric properties influence signal speed, impedance, and general electrical behavior, understanding what is dielectric constant or dielectric constant meaning is important in board design. In high frequency PCBs, RF boards, and high frequency printed circuit card projects, choosing the ideal laminate can be just as important as picking the right components.

Some boards require advanced interconnect capabilities. High density interconnect PCB, HDI PCB, HDI boards, HDI printed circuit card, microvia, blind via, buried via, and via in PCB technologies are used to create smaller, a lot more complex layouts with finer traces and even more routing density. These attributes are common in smart devices, wearables, aerospace PCBs, automotive PCB systems, and other products where room is limited and performance is important. Rigid flex PCB, rigid-flex PCB, rigid flex circuit, and flexible PCB board designs combine rigid sections with flexible circuitry so the board can fit or bend right into uncommon enclosures. Flexible PCB manufacturers, flex circuit manufacturer companies, and flexible printed circuit manufacturers sustain items that need repetitive motion, light-weight construction, or portable packaging. Bendable motherboard and flexible circuitry options are specifically useful in medical devices, cameras, robotics, and aerospace applications.

Fiducial marks PCB, PCB fiducials, fiducial PCB, and fiducial marks assist assembly devices recognize board placement throughout pick-and-place and solder printing. PCB stencil and circuit board stencil are used in SMT process and stencil in PCB process to apply solder paste precisely.
